public class LookupTables
extends java.lang.Object
Modifier and Type | Class and Description |
---|---|
static class |
LookupTables.EnumerationLiterals
The lists of enumeration literals for each enumeration.
|
static class |
LookupTables.FragmentOperations
The lists of local operations or local operation overrides for each fragment of each type.
|
static class |
LookupTables.FragmentProperties
The lists of local properties for the local fragment of each type.
|
static class |
LookupTables.Fragments
The fragment descriptors for the local elements of each type and its supertypes.
|
static class |
LookupTables.Operations
The operation descriptors for each operation of each type.
|
static class |
LookupTables.Parameters
The parameter lists shared by operations.
|
static class |
LookupTables.Properties
The property descriptors for each property of each type.
|
static class |
LookupTables.TypeFragments
The fragments for all base types in depth order: OclAny first, OclSelf last.
|
static class |
LookupTables.TypeParameters
The type parameters for templated types and operations.
|
static class |
LookupTables.Types
The type descriptors for each type.
|
Modifier and Type | Field and Description |
---|---|
static CollectionTypeId |
BAG_CLSSid_LookupEnvironment |
static ClassId |
CLSSid_Executor |
static ClassId |
CLSSid_LookupEnvironment |
static ClassId |
CLSSid_NamedElement |
static CollectionTypeId |
COL_PRIMid_OclAny
Constants used by auto-generated code.
|
static CollectionTypeId |
COL_TMPLid_ |
static ExecutorStandardLibrary |
LIBRARY
The library of all packages and types.
|
static CollectionTypeId |
ORD_CLSSid_NamedElement |
static EcoreExecutorPackage |
PACKAGE
The package descriptor for the package.
|
static RootPackageId |
PACKid_$metamodel$ |
static NsURIPackageId |
PACKid_http_c_s_s_www_eclipse_org_s_ocl_s_2015_s_Lookup |
static PropertyId |
PROPid_namedElements |
Constructor and Description |
---|
LookupTables() |
Modifier and Type | Method and Description |
---|---|
static void |
init() |
@NonNull public static final EcoreExecutorPackage PACKAGE
@NonNull public static final ExecutorStandardLibrary LIBRARY
public static final CollectionTypeId COL_PRIMid_OclAny
public static final CollectionTypeId COL_TMPLid_
public static final RootPackageId PACKid_$metamodel$
public static final NsURIPackageId PACKid_http_c_s_s_www_eclipse_org_s_ocl_s_2015_s_Lookup
public static final ClassId CLSSid_Executor
public static final ClassId CLSSid_LookupEnvironment
public static final ClassId CLSSid_NamedElement
public static final CollectionTypeId BAG_CLSSid_LookupEnvironment
public static final CollectionTypeId ORD_CLSSid_NamedElement
public static final PropertyId PROPid_namedElements